Drummer And Entrepreneur Camellia Akhamie Kies speaks to T.L. Mazumdar
While best known for her prolific Social Media content showcasing her unique hybrid approach to drums, percussion, spoken word, and DJ'ing, behind the powerhouse of the positive force that is Camellia Akhamie Kies, is a military veteran, a mother, an entrepreneur, and the deep soul of a fierce and positive energy that overcomes real-life obstacles with the grace and skill aptly representative of the same. In this long-form deep dive into the journey that has been, we cover a broad range of topics including the impact of a nomadic childhood on artists, balancing athletic and musical lifestyles, the 'goo' between 16th notes, the power of choice in times of pain and motherhood as an internationally touring professional musician.

Camellia Akhamie Kies is the founder and CEO of
Akhamie Music, LLC & Beach Drum Shed ™, she is a military veteran, a graduate from the Navy School of Music, and a graduate from the University of Maryland University College.
Camellia currently holds a BS in Digital Media & Web Technology, a minor in Business Administration, and a Certification in Management Foundations
Born in Heidelberg, Germany in 1989, Camellia expressed deep interest in music from a very young age. During High School she began to study drums and percussion privately with Myles Overton III from The United States Army Band "Pershing's Own". For several years during and after High School Overton mentored and trained Camellia in all areas of drums and percussion.
In June 2008 Camellia graduated from Woodbridge Senior High School, and shortly after receiving her diploma she auditioned and was accepted into the United States Navy Music Program, she served 6 years in the US Navy Fleet Band as a full time drummer and percussionist, she lived in Yokosuka, Japan for the majority of her service and while she was stationed there she traveled the Pacific Rim performing in over fifteen countries with the US Navy 7th Fleet Band.
Camellia's stage presence and musicianship are electrifying, she has always been called a crowd favorite by spectators and band mates.
